Brainstorming
1. Leader: State problem clearly. 2. Group: Make suggestions orally.3. Leader: Reword and write down ideas.4. Leader: Encourage participation.5. Group: Evaluate/rank ideas.

Nominal Group Technique
1. Leader: State problem.2. Individuals: Make suggestions in turn.3. Leader: Display ideas.4. Group: Vote for best ideas.5. Leader: Tally votes.6. Group: Discuss top ideas further.

Structured Search: SEARCH
S Simplify operationsE Eliminate unnecessary work and
materialA Alter sequence (change)R RequirementsC Combine operationsH How often

Quality (Capability) Costs
• Determine if the level of quality is appropriate and worth the cost.
• Review design tolerances before release to production.
• Allow for concealed costs (unreported rework causes “eddies in the river”).
• Pay attention to indirect materials, supplies, and utility costs.
• Consider selective assembly.

Initial vs. Continuing Costs
• Minimize life-cycle costs, not just initial purchase cost.
• Identify maintenance, operating, and utility costs.
• Expect noneconomic behavior when cost is ignored.

How Often?
• Use economic lot size calculations.– Trade off setup costs vs. inventory for “make”
items– Trade off purchasing cost vs. inventory for
“buy” items• Analyze maintenance, service, and
inspection activities.• Use red/yellow/green labels to concentrate
resources where needed.
